SG. Y1749 variety. £5.00 Deep sepia brown printed by DLR in 2003 using IRIODIN ink. This colour was not authorised by the post office and was consequently changed to Azure. A RARE trial printing.

SG. 417. N71 variety. 10/- EXPERIMENTAL PLATE PROOF in black on soft white card. In 1929 Bradbury produced a few small sheets of 9. A superb VERY RARE left hand marginal block of 4.
